How much do concrete driver j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 1, 2026, the average hourly pay for concrete driver in Rialto, CA is $22.45,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.52 and $24.81 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a concrete driver do?

A concrete driver, also known as a concrete mixer truck driver, is responsible for safely transporting and delivering ready-mix concrete from a batching plant to construction sites. They operate specialized trucks equipped with rotating drums that keep the concrete mixed and ready to pour. In addition to driving, concrete drivers may assist with unloading the concrete, maintaining the truck, and ensuring timely delivery according to customer specifications. Safety, punctuality, and knowledge of local traffic laws are key aspects of the job.

What are some typical challenges faced by concrete drivers on the job, and how are they addressed?

Concrete drivers often face challenges such as navigating tight construction sites, managing time-sensitive deliveries, and ensuring the quality of the concrete during transport. To address these issues, drivers must be skilled in maneuvering large vehicles in confined spaces and communicate closely with site personnel to coordinate safe unloading. Additionally, they follow strict protocols to prevent concrete from setting in the drum, which may include adjusting speed, using drum rotation, and monitoring weather conditions. Ongoing training and teamwork with dispatchers and site managers are key to overcoming these challenges.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a concrete driver,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Concrete Driver, you need a valid commercial driver’s license (CDL), knowledge of safe vehicle operation, and basic math skills for measuring and mixing concrete. Familiarity with concrete mixer trucks, GPS navigation systems, and safety protocols is typically required. Dependability, strong communication, and the ability to work independently are important soft skills in this role. These skills ensure timely and accurate concrete deliveries while maintaining high safety standards and customer satisfaction.

How to become a concrete driver?

To become a concrete driver, you typically need a valid commercial driver's license (CDL), experience operating large vehicles, and knowledge of safety procedures. Some employers may require training on concrete mixer trucks and adherence to Department of Transportation (DOT) regulations.
